-
Posts
92 -
Joined
-
Last visited
Content Type
Downloads
Release Notes
IPS4 Guides
IPS4 Developer Documentation
Invision Community Blog
Development Blog
Deprecation Tracker
Providers Directory
Projects
Release Notes v5
Forums
Events
Store
Gallery
Posts posted by Mike G.
-
-
-
Hey team,
I was using extra fields and testing club filters on the sidebar widget. I deleted the extra field being used to filter, which resulted in an error on the homepage, making the sidebar widget unaccessible. I wasn't able to resolve the error until I disabled the club's application, which allowed me to access the club sidebar widget to delete it.
Although I was able to resolve it, I wanted to share in-case it's a bug or comes up again in the future.Error Code Received:
SELECT COUNT(*) FROM `core_clubs` LEFT JOIN `core_clubs_fieldvalues` ON core_clubs_fieldvalues.club_id=core_clubs.id WHERE ( FIND_IN_SET('Gaming',field_21) )
IPS\Db\Exception: Unknown column 'field_21' in 'where clause' (1054)
#0 {DIR} /system/Db/Select.php(388): IPS\_Db->preparedQuery()
#1 {DIR} /system/Db/Select.php(446): IPS\Db\_Select->runQuery()
#2 {DIR} /system/Db/Select.php(370): IPS\Db\_Select->rewind()
#3 {DIR} /system/Member/Club/Club.php(255): IPS\Db\_Select->first()
#4 {DIR} /applications/core/widgets/clubs.php(165): IPS\Member\_Club::clubs()
#5 {DIR} /system/Widget/Widget.php(826): IPS\core\widgets\_clubs->render()
#6 {DIR} /system/Widget/Widget.php(926): IPS\_Widget->_render()
#7 {DIR} /system/Theme/Theme.php(885) : eval()'d code(18979): IPS\_Widget->__toString()
#8 {DIR} /system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->widgetContainer()
#9 {DIR} /system/Theme/Theme.php(885) : eval()'d code(16153): IPS\Theme\_SandboxedTemplate->__call()
#10 {DIR} /system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->sidebar()
#11{DIR} /system/Theme/Theme.php(885) : eval()'d code(7331): IPS\Theme\_SandboxedTemplate->__call()
#12 {DIR} /system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->globalTemplate()
#13 {DIR} /system/Dispatcher/Dispatcher.php(173): IPS\Theme\_SandboxedTemplate->__call()
#14 {DIR} /system/Dispatcher/Standard.php(113): IPS\_Dispatcher->finish()
#15 {DIR} /system/Dispatcher/Front.php(567): IPS\Dispatcher\_Standard->finish()
#16 {DIR} /system/Dispatcher/Dispatcher.php(155): IPS\Dispatcher\_Front->finish()
#17 {DIR} /index.php(13): IPS\_Dispatcher->run()
#18 {main} -
Thanks for all the thought and innovation put into the new pages functionality.
P.S. Dr. Seuss would be proud of that video.
- Myr, Marc Stridgen, PrettyPixels and 3 others
-
2
-
3
-
1
-
On 6/7/2024 at 4:15 AM, Matt said:
Think of it like organising your house. You have a lot of things that can be hard to find (I know I had a charging cable here somewhere...) so you buy 10 large plastic crates and organise everything into those boxes (electronics, clothes, toys, cables, etc). You label each crate and it's now easy to find what you want. Need a charging cable? Open the cables box. Need to find your Gameboy (it's 1999 in my head) then go to the electronics box. It's easy.
If you then added a bunch of rules on top (blue cables can't go into any box... I see what you mean. Thanks for this 😁
-
I expected some improvements, but I was cautiously optimistic about how much of an improvement it could be.
This massively exceeds my expectations and it's that bridge that will really help unify everything - which has been my biggest challenge to figure out.
Thank you.
P.S. Even more impressive is how the team is able to not talk about it in advance.
-
-
22 hours ago, superaven said:
Originally I had heard March as a tentative release date and as that drew to a close, I read April. Would be awesome to get more regular updates, but I can understands if it gets frustrating for the staff when dates slip and people respond poorly to that delay. Hoping to see some updates soon!
That's always a risk with sharing tentative dates and timelines. Over sharing can cause issues as well since things can change before being finalized. Along with that, you never know what setbacks (or opportunities) will pop up.
I'm always checking for the next update (we were spoiled last fall), but with such a major overhaul, let's let them cook.
Reading between the lines, it feels like there are some updates being made to core features that should help IC5 hang with some of the more well-known CMS's out there.
The initial goal I saw was releasing a beta before the end of 2023 with a Q1 2024 release. Planning to be an early adopter, I shared with my community an update would be coming in 2024 and hopefully before the college football season in September.
Either I'm clairvoyant or I've been involved with too many development projects 😂
I hope this didn't come across the wrong way. It can be very difficult to provide regular updates when there's so much liable to change.
- Matt Finger, David N. and SeNioR-
-
1
-
2
-
9 hours ago, Marc Stridgen said:
I suspect thats more a reflection of the tool using to do that check, to be honest
Thanks for the reply, @Marc Stridgen. You can see it reflected in the source code as well. Best practice is to have the canonical be self-referencing, which would include the forward slash, here.
You can access the source code by pasting this into the address bar:
view-source:https://invisioncommunity.com/Example of a self-referencing canonical:
The extension I'm using is mostly for spot-checking on the fly, but it's been an excellent resource for quickly checking on-page elements.
-
This isn't 100% related to the first message, but also not enough to warrant a new topic, imo.
The homepage canonical is set to the url without the forward slash at the end, which looks to be the case for all Invision Community homepages. I don't believe it influences indexability, but thought it was worth sharing.
-
-
-
When I enable the combined fluid view, it shows topics from throughout the community. I'll leave it enabled on one of my forums for reference.
Example: https://www.fanclubs.org/forum/707-bulletin-board/
Please let me know if there's anything you need from me, and thanks again!
-
Hey Invision Team,
I have a proposal for a settings change, which I think makes sense for sites that feature clubs. This is the current setting.
Show Club Content Areas:
- Only within Clubs
- Throughout the community
I have a setup that allows members to join numerous clubs and I would like to allow members to only see their club's content throughout the community. I think the simple approach would be to use a filter like this.
Clubs to show throughout the community:
- Public
- Open
- Clubs member has joined
- Read Only
- All / None
If this problem isn't unique to me, I think the flexibility here would add value to the clubs. Thanks!
-
50 minutes ago, FanClub Mike said:
I have a member having a similar problem where they're constantly getting logged out. They're using Firefox as well, and they're on Rodgers Internet.
Before are my enabled plugins and applications if you want to see if there's any overlap.
Applications:
- Topic Thumbnails
- Font Awesome 6
- Antispam by Cleantalk
Plugins:
- Delete all system logs button
- Legend News
- Live Topics
Didn't expect to follow-up so soon, but it seems to be resolved. This member was having the problem for weeks. They just uninstalled and reinstalled Firefox and said that did the trick. 🤷♂️
-
I have a member having a similar problem where they're constantly getting logged out. They're using Firefox as well, and they're on Rodgers Internet.
Before are my enabled plugins and applications if you want to see if there's any overlap.
Applications:
- Topic Thumbnails
- Font Awesome 6
- Antispam by Cleantalk
Plugins:
- Delete all system logs button
- Legend News
- Live Topics
-
-
1 hour ago, Dreadknux said:
I can't wait to see what new pages are added to the story! 🙈
-
Although I've been okay regarding spam registrations (knock on wood), I got an email from Cloudflare this evening about a big spike in automated (bot) traffic.
-
I agree that Clubs are underutilized by many communities, but it's up to the Community Admin to determine if adding clubs would add value to their users. I've seen some very active communities that have had clubs for years, but zero activity in them.
Clubs are critical for my site, and the the direction I'm heading with Fan Clubs. Just because it makes sense for me doesn't mean that's the case for everyone, though. Managing a community is a lot of work and it doesn't always make sense to dilute your often limited resources to build something many may not use.
However, for the communities it does make sense, it's absolutely worth exploring.
-
6 minutes ago, Jim M said:
Would check your CloudFlare configuration to ensure that you're not blocking requests from your own server. That likely is why the warning about URL rewriting is coming up.
Would also check that your theme is up to date and compatible with the latest release as well. There was an old issue of the next button in the Gallery looping back through already seen images but that was resolve a bit ago.
Thank you for your help with the rewrite issue, @Jim M. I knew it probably had to do with Cloudflare and I wish I reached out sooner.
Regarding the images, my theme is up to date, but even after switching to the default IPS theme, it still loops between two photos after a certain point. I also enabled the default theme as an option for guests if you wanted to replicate it.
I tested multiple galleries but so far I only noticed the issue on the one gallery I shared above.
Thank you again for your help.
-
I've been having an issue with the URL rewrite option that I can't seem to resolve on my site, despite having everything setup the right way from what I can tell. I'll share some notes and what I've tried so far.
Warning I'm receiving:
The rewriting does not seem to be working. This may be because you have not uploaded the .htaccess file, but may be a false error if your community is not generally accessible. Check friendly URLs are working, and if they are not, ensure you have uploaded the .htaccess file correctly or contact technical support for assistance.Notes:
- The issue is present on fanclubs.org
- Despite getting the error, URLs are rewriting.
- Redirects in the htaccess file are also working
- I don't have any custom URLs in place
- I'm not sure if this is related, but some galleries begin to loop while scrolling. Example here
A few troubleshooting attempts:
- Disabled all 3rd party plugins and applications
- Reverting to the default .htaccess provided in AdminCP made no change
- Disabling and re-enabling the rewrite options didn't resolve it.
If anyone has any suggestions, I'd appreciate it. I know the IPS team's hands are full too, but if you get a chance to jump in, my IPS Access info is up-to-date.
Thanks
-
Creating an app and submitting to the app store is definitely on my roadmap for Fan Clubs, and I'd like to do the same for my other community as well at some point.
I don't expect to get to that until at least 2025, however.
If it's helpful, I have submitted a web app of my site to the Google Play store packaged as an APK site years ago with no issues. Back then I was on WordPress and I'm sure a lot has changed since, though.
-
16 minutes ago, superaven said:
Hey, been a minute since I've been here. I've left my forum largely on auto pilot for the last two years and finally in a place to take the next step in the evolution of our community.
Apologies ahead of time for the noob questions but really not finding the answers by searching around. Reached out to sales and got a one sentence reply that wasn't especially helpful, so here I am. I will state ahead of time that spent a couple hours looking t all the blog / news entires regarding v5 and was blown away. It feels like in my absence, Invision has pulled past trying to compete toe to toe with social media on features and finally found their way towards developing a true alternative that might attract back members that were lost to social media. Anyhow, I'm impressed. Feels like some of the largest changes to forum systems like this one to happen in the last decade took place in this last year or two.
Questions:
1. It appears that v5 will not be made available for set hosted customers, but wanted to confirm that.
2. If so, I also assume that there's like an end of life plan for v4 and self hosted installs of Invision Community?
3. I assume that v5 is already out, but I'm not entirely sure of that since it appears this community isn't running on v5?
--------
Wondering if anyone on here running their own community has moved from self hosted v4 to the cloud based v5 (assuming it's available)? If so, what has the experience been like? How was scheduling and migration? How has the service been for you? How good has customer / technical support been for you?
Anyhow, the hosting packages appear pretty competitive when you factor in everything from license, storage and system resources, but I must admit that it makes me nervous giving up self hosting for SaaS type solutions. Just hoping for a few answers and some feedback before we make a final decision.
Thank you in advance.
Hey Superaven. Welcome back to the fun! I also love the direction things are heading with Invision Community. I'll do my best to answer your questions, below, but in a slightly different order than asked 😁
- IC5 is still in development and not yet publicly available. It will be released this year, but may still be a few months away based on recent comments from management.
- There will be self-hosted and cloud plans for IC5. Some features will only be available on the Cloud plans
- Invision Community 4 will be supported until 2025/2026 according to the Depreciation Tracker.
I'm looking forward to everything in the pipeline as well. Glad you're here for the next step / (r)evolution 😎
- superaven and Alexander Newman
-
1
-
1
-
1 hour ago, LFIWebMaster said:
Our community is REALLY enjoying the club feature. We have 15 and will launch more in the future. The list of clubs is now getting...long and a little confusing for our members to search through.
We have a few informal categories of clubs that we use and it would be amazing to be able to logically group those club categories in some way on the front of the club page...or even create separate top level pages for each category of club.
Hey @LFIWebMaster.
Clubs are the bread and butter of one of my communities, so I'll go ahead and share some things that work well for me.
If you want to see how the filters work (option 1 below) or see how I'm managing an insane amount of Clubs, my site is fanclubs.org. The site is still a work in progress, but the fundamentals and structure are mostly finalized.
Option 1 - Create Extra Fields for Clubs
This option is native to Invision Community and will allow members filter clubs by the fields specified.
For simple categorization, I would recommend using the Radio Field Type. New clubs would be required to select a category when they create the club. Existing clubs can be updated using the club settings.
A few alternative fields that would work
- Checkbox Set - Club owners can select multiple checkbox options
- Select Box - I find this to be better for an expansive list of options
If you use this feature, make sure you enable filtering when you set up Extra Fields. Not only can members filter by these options, but Club widgets as well.
A look at my Extra Field for Categories
Option 2 - Clubs Category Application (Adriano)
I was using the Clubs Category application shared above until I figured out how to structure Extra Fields for my community. For a plug-and-play solution, the Clubs Category App is a great option.
With the Clubs Category application, navigation links are added to the sidebar on the Clubs page for easy navigation, you can add font-awesome icons, and it's easy to link to since the categories have SEO-friendly URLs.
Cover photos should show entire photo when clicked
in Feedback
Posted
Forgive me is I'm misinterpreting it, but I think what @Aramaech is referring to is the way repositioned cover photos expand.
On IPS4, when you click to expand the image, it only expands below the positioned part of the photo, while on IC5 it expands both above and below, showing the full cover photo when clicked.